摘要
The eccentricity errors of each piece in the planet gear train set are described. This paper has made a tentative study on the determination of load-sharing displacement with formulas of equivalent errors. It takes the flexible pin roll as the load-sharing piece and LevelT planet gear drive in the speed-increasing gearbox of some wind power generator for the case study. The results show i) that the radial error of each piece does not influence the operation of the planet gear train, but the tangential error does influence the load-sharing among the planet gears; and ii) that the load sharing displacement is determined by the centering tangential equivalent error of the flexible pin roll, which may provide reference to projects.
